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
112 64721734 616140317 894764 5598
1781286353 421341489
1781286353 421341489
021 14 41194597235 16953930
All about undefined
Interested in learning more?
1781286353 421341489
021 14 41194597235 16953930
See more
70424782649 594639
798161 357804403 21 29854
See more
80129 07383198
1404 42767167 798327 41092203
See more